Utsha Residency is a space where creative minds devoted to diverse disciplines come together to create, interact and reflect upon the complex discourses through their work. Exchange of techniques, experiences, and skills across the countries under the ambit of a facilitated residency is always useful in understanding the diversities in culture. Our Residency Programme is customised to support the specific needs of Artists working in multiple disciplines, from around the world.

Know MoreLibrary Timings: 11 am – 5 pm, Monday – Friday At Utsha, we have a constructive, publicly owned, free library system that is accessible to all age groups and backgrounds.Through such a system, we aim to address the crisis by bringing book access to communities in need. Library at Utsha, stores books, magazines mostly donated by organisations. At times they are bought by us, if required.
